Bichon Frise vs Maltese vs Beagle Size and Weight Comparison
Size Classification
Compare size differences between Bichon Frise, Maltese, and Beagle. Which breed is the largest? | Small | Small | Small |
---|---|---|---|
Weight Statistics
How do weights compare between Bichon Frise, Maltese, and Beagle? Compare adult weight ranges. | 7-13 pounds (3-6 kg) | 6.5-9 pounds (3-4 kg) | Male: 22-25 pounds (10-11 kg), Female: 20-23 pounds (9-10 kg) |
Average Weight
Which dog has a smaller / higher average weight? | 10 pounds (4.5 kg) | 6.7 pounds (3.5 kg) | Male: 23.5 pounds (10.5 kg), Female: 21.5 pounds (9.5 kg) |
Height
Which is taller, Bichon Frise or Maltese or Beagle? Bichon Frise vs Maltese vs Beagle height comparison: | Male: 9-12 inches (23–30 cm) Female: 9-11 inches (23-28 cm) | Male: 8-10 inches (21-25 cm), Female: 8-9 inches (20-23 cm) | Male: 14-16 inches (36-41 cm), Female: 13-15 inches (33-38 cm) |
Average Height
Which dog has a smaller / higher average height? | Male: 10.5 inches (26.5 cm) Female: 10 inches (25.5 cm) | Male: 9 inches (23 cm), Female: 8.5 inches (21.5 cm) | Male: 15 inches (38.5 cm), Female: 14 inches (35.5 cm) |

Health Problems
Which one has more or less genetic/health problems: Bichon Frise vs Maltese vs Beagle? What are the allergies, genetic diseases and concerns for them? Bichon Frise vs Maltese vs Beagle health problems comparison: | Hip Dysplasia Patellar Luxation Allergies Vaccination Sensitivity Bladder Stones Juvenile Cataracts |
Collapsed Trachea Patellar Luxation Progressive retinal atrophy (PRA) Portosystemic Liver Shunt Reverse Sneezing Hypoglycemia White Dog Shaker Syndrome | Hip Dysplasia Patellar Luxation Hypothyroidism Progressive retinal atrophy (PRA) Epilepsy Intervertebral Disk Disease Cherry Eye Distichiasis Glaucoma Beagle Dwarfism Chinese Beagle Syndrome |

Bichon Frise vs Maltese vs Beagle Recognition Comparison
AKC Classification
Compare AKC groups for Bichon Frise, Maltese, and Beagle. How are they classified? |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1972 as a Non-Sporting bre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1888 as a Toy bre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1885 as a Hound breed. |
---|---|---|---|
FCI Classification
Compare FCI groups for Bichon Frise, Maltese, and Beagle. How are they classified internationally? | Not recognized by FCI. | Recognized by FCI in the Companion and Toy Dogs group, in the Bichons and related breeds section. | Recognized by FCI in the Scent hounds and related breeds group, in the Scent hounds section. |
